Transaction 052671d6b59bc3d1ddbacab1e1e74b51bcde6b0d2c616d5bf1514e3dd12dbfa9
1 Input
1 Output
-
052671d6b59bc3d1ddbacab1e1e74b51bcde6b0d2c616d5bf1514e3dd12dbfa9:0
- value
- 21850515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59c7ef8ea11caf176edd083eab57cbee5cdfa675 OP_EQUAL
- address
- 39sjaQ1U47jwcfhYooRfeys9JGzu578xX6